What Is Ziti Al Forno?
Ziti al forno is a baked pasta casserole featuring short, tube-shaped ziti coated in a rich tomato or meat-based sauce, layered with cheese, herbs, and often ricotta or ground meat. While the basic components are familiar, the interior — the hidden fusion of textures and flavors — is where true mastery lies.

The Layering Technique
What makes ziti al forno magical is its layered construction. Chefs don’t simply bake layers—they bind them with a precise sauce-marinating method: after parboiling the ziti, chefs toss it in a warm, herb-infused sauce (basil, oregano, garlic) infused with a spoonful of tomato consomme. The ziti absorbs the sauce fully, ensuring every bite bursts with flavor.
Then, a layer of toasted mozzarella mixed with breadcrumbs and grated Pecorino is sprinkled evenly. Before baking, chefs often brush the top with a light Mignardise of olive oil and herbs, giving the crust a deep golden hue and a fragrant finish. The final bake—usually under a crispy broiler at 400°F—appears simple but ensures a melt-in-your-mouth texture and bubbling perfection.

How to Try Your Own Secret Ziti Al Forno
- Start with short ziti — their shape locks in sauce beautifully.
- Toast barley or breadcrumbs in olive oil to deepen flavor.
- Build a vibrant, herb-forward tomato base with core ingredients like San Marzano tomatoes and garlic.
- Use aged Parmigiano to enrich sauces and finish with a touch of saffron or lemon zest.
- Layer gently, bake until bubbling, and indulge in that perfect contrast of creamy, crispy, and aromatic.
